Roll Call

In universities, taking attendance is a daunting task. In particular, in 250+ student lecture class. Often, there are teacher's assistants hired to take attendance. Roll Call was designed to tackle the task of keeping record of students' attendance, ultimately freeing up unnecessary time that can be better spent on class curriculum. Students are able to check-in to the class with the app and download any notes or materials for that class-day from their phone. The interface of the app is easily color coordinated for the student and teachers to identify their classes. In order to ensure a cheat-proof system, a series of high-frequency audible codes only heard by the phone is emitted throughout the room. To successfully check - in the code must match the correct time it is being emitted.
